The Dick Van Dyke Show: Bad Reception in Albany
Overview
Rob and Laura are attending a wedding in Albany, Rob is asked by Alan to watch a fashion show. He promises to tell Alan what he thought of it. Rob has to hurry to the church to usher a wedding.

Episode context
Bad Reception in Albany is Episode 23 in Season 5 of The Dick Van Dyke Show. It aired on 1966-03-09. The runtime is 25 min.
